浅谈配置Linux主域名服务器文件
作者 佚名技术
来源 Linux系统
浏览
发布时间 2012-04-07
空的文件,名字为abc.com.zone ,该名称是由named.conf 中对应区域的 file 项指定的名称.在文件中输入以下代码: $TTL 86400 @ IN SOA abc.com root.abc.com.( 2008072001;serial 28800 ;refresh 14400 ;retry 86400 ;expire 86400) ;minimum @ IN NS dns.abc.com. @ IN MX 10 mail.abc.com. dns.abc.com IN A 192.168.124.128 www.abc.com IN A 192.168.124.129 mail.abc.com IN A 192.168.124.130 ftp IN CNAME www 根据前面的任务情境给出了dns 主机、www主机 、mail主机 及ftp 主机的域名解析资源记录.区域的首部给出了SOA资源记录,SOA资源记录包含5个相关参数.这5个参数都是用来控制主域名服务器与辅助服务器的同步操作. 常用资源记录类型: SOA 区域的起始授权资源记录 NS 该区域的域名服务器资源记录 A 正向解析资源记录,域名到IP 地址的转换 PTR 反向解析资源记录,IP地址到域名的转换MX 该区域的邮件资源记录 CNAME 主机的别名资源记录 四、编写新增反向区域文件 124.168.192.in-addr.arpa.zone . [root@localhost ~]#vi /var/named/chroot/var/named/124.168.192.in-addr.arpa.zone 在指定目录下建立一个空的文件,名字为124.168.192.in-addr.arpa.zone ,该名称是由named.conf 中对应区域的file项指定的名称. 在文件中输入以下代码: $TTL 86400 @ IN SOA abc.com root.abc.com.( 2008072001;serial 28800 ;refresh 14400 ;retry 86400 ;expire 86400) ;minimum @ IN NS dns.abc.com. 128.124.168.192.in-addr.arpa. IN PTR dns.abc.com. 129 IN PTR www.abc.com. 130 IN PTR mail.abc.com. 五、利用 rndc 控制DNS服务器. 使用下列命令生成rndc.conf 文件. [root@localhost ~]#rndc-confgen >>/etc/rndc.conf 查看 rndc.conf ,将下列代码添加到 named.conf 文件中,使 rncd 可以远程控制 named服务. key "rndckey" { algorithm hmac-md5; secret "oYXwrXp89HnCQ0bOTS0zQA=="; }; controls { inet 127.0.0.1 port 953 allow {127.0.0.1;} keys {"rndckey";}; }; 在rndc.conf 中定义了key 和controls 两个区域的相关设定,若caching-nameserver 自动生成的主配置文件 named.conf 中已包含这两个区域配置,应修改 named.conf ,这两个区域相关设定与 rndc.conf 一致即可,主要是key区域中secret 选项需要同步.使用rndc reload 命令 |
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|
你可能对下面的文章感兴趣
上一篇: FreeBSD和Linux之比较下一篇: linux 性能检测工具之 dstat
关于浅谈配置Linux主域名服务器文件的所有评论